Transaction 80af127230c25ad270a5ac3cc8b983c2646e6a13cf72c25cb5dd8672d60ec80a

2 Input
2 Outputs
  • 80af127230c25ad270a5ac3cc8b983c2646e6a13cf72c25cb5dd8672d60ec80a:0
  • value  247636
    address  12e7gUv8hLA4Ky3rYy4LVvsErQCrQjhzhw
  • 80af127230c25ad270a5ac3cc8b983c2646e6a13cf72c25cb5dd8672d60ec80a:1
  • value  2435995
    address  3NRoVotYEiaRPXgvZGBWXFv7tMeQFw238Z